MENDOTA – The Mendota Garden Club and the city of Mendota recently teamed up to clear small trees and brush from Mendota Creek to preserve the integrity of retaining walls and also to enhance the flow of water in the creek. Working in a section of creek between Jefferson and Monroe streets are Steve Lauer of the Mendota Garden Club, right, and Ethan Guelde of the city.
